Transaction 959389bdde78bd37331f20d8fa4bd984284a4c4a682fecbcc40ca9efe704471b
1 Input
1 Output
-
959389bdde78bd37331f20d8fa4bd984284a4c4a682fecbcc40ca9efe704471b:0
- value
- 73760
- script pubkey
- OP_0 OP_PUSHBYTES_20 f74db423cb9196d2943c2b21a42e3e88df0cb328
- address
- bc1q7axmgg7tjxtd99pu9vs6gt373r0sevegztz93s